KATHMANDU, May 2: Player of the match Bhuvan Karki scored 20 runs and picked up two wickets to help departmental team Armed Police Force Club (APF) defeat Mahendranagar Cricket Academy by 18 runs to reach the semifinals of the ongoing second season of Karnali Premier League. APF finished on top of Group B by winning the last group match played at Kalinchowk Cricket Ground in Surkhet on Wednesday.

KATHMANDU, May 1: In a clash of departmental teams, Armed Police Force Club (APF) defeated Tribhuvan Army Club in straight sets of 25-14, 29-9, 25-15 to win the fifth KNP National Women Volleyball Tournament held at Nepal Army’s Training and Coaching Covered Hall in Lalitpur on Tuesday. This is APF’s fifth KNP title.
